通过人工智能实现多个对象精确对齐是一个复杂但有趣的挑战。在实际应用中,这通常涉及到图像处理和计算机视觉技术,以及深度学习算法。下面是一些关键步骤和策略:
1. 预处理阶段
(1)图像获取
- 多目标识别:使用图像识别技术,如卷积神经网络(CNN),来自动识别出图片中的目标物体。这需要训练一个能够识别多种不同形状和大小的物体的模型。
- 数据收集:收集大量的标注数据,这些数据应包含多种环境下的目标物体,以及它们在不同角度和距离下的图像。
(2)特征提取
- 特征点检测:使用SIFT、SURF等算法提取关键点,这些关键点是描述图像局部特征的重要工具。
- 边缘检测:通过Canny边缘检测或Sobel边缘检测等方法提取边缘信息,这对于后续的特征匹配至关重要。
(3)图像标准化
- 归一化:将图像从尺寸、亮度和对比度等方面进行标准化,以便于后续的处理和分析。
- 色彩空间转换:将图像从RGB转换为HSV或LUV等颜色空间,以便更好地处理颜色信息。
2. 特征匹配阶段
(1)特征点匹配
- 特征点匹配算法:采用如FLANN、BFMatcher等高效算法,快速计算特征点之间的相似性度量。
- 阈值设定:根据实际应用场景设定合适的阈值,以确保匹配结果的准确性。
(2)RANSAC
- 随机抽样一致性:利用RANSAC算法进行迭代优化,剔除错误的匹配点,提高最终结果的稳定性和可靠性。
- 参数估计:根据RANSAC算法的结果,估计出最优的相机外参和单应性矩阵,为后续的目标对齐提供基础。
(3)立体视觉
- 立体标定:利用立体标定方法,如双目立体视觉或多目立体视觉,获取深度信息。
- 立体匹配:结合立体标定的结果,进行立体匹配,以获得准确的三维坐标信息。
3. 目标对齐与融合
(1)对齐算法
- 基于特征的对齐:利用已匹配的特征点,通过最小二乘法等优化方法进行对齐。
- 迭代优化:采用迭代优化算法,如梯度下降法,不断调整对齐参数,直到达到满意的对齐效果。
(2)融合策略
- 加权平均:根据不同特征的重要性,采用加权平均的方法进行融合,以提高最终结果的准确性。
- 融合后处理:对融合后的图像进行后处理,如去噪、锐化等,以提高最终输出的质量。
4. 实验与评估
(1)数据集评估
- 评价指标:选择适当的评价指标,如平均绝对误差(MAE)、均方根误差(RMSE)等,对对齐效果进行客观评估。
- 性能分析:分析实验结果,找出影响对齐精度的关键因素,为进一步优化算法提供依据。
(2)真实场景测试
- 场景适应性:在不同的真实应用场景下测试算法的性能,确保其具有良好的泛化能力。
- 实时性要求:对于需要实时处理的场景,考虑算法的运行效率和实时性表现。
总之,通过上述步骤和方法,可以有效地利用人工智能技术实现多个对象精确对齐。需要注意的是,这一过程可能需要大量的数据支持和复杂的算法设计,但对于提升自动化水平和提高生产效率具有重要意义。